红米ac2100路由器刷padavan系统


更新2.0.7固件并获取root权限

ac2100通电连网线(右3个孔)或wifi后,打开本地浏览器输入192.168.31.1,右上角选择固件升级,选择2.0.7固件,下载地址

http://openwrt.ink:8666/%E5%AE%98%E6%96%B9%E5%B7%A5%E5%85%B7%E5%8C%85/%E7%BA%A2%E7%B1%B3AC2100/%E5%AE%98%E6%96%B9%E5%9B%BA%E4%BB%B6/miwifi_rm2100_firmware_d6234_2.0.7.bin

重启后,进入路由管理界面192.168.31.1,网址类似这种形式:http://192.168.31.1/cgi-bin/luci/;stok=abcdefg1234567890
abcdefg1234567890这段代码每个机器不同,需要保留,在这段代码后面,添加以下网址:

1
/api/misystem/set_config_iotdev?bssid=Xiaomi&user_id=longdike&ssid=-h%3B%20nvram%20set%20ssh_en%3D1%3B%20nvram%20commit%3B%20sed%20-i%20's%2Fchannel%3D.*%2Fchannel%3D%5C%22debug%5C%22%2Fg'%20%2Fetc%2Finit.d%2Fdropbear%3B%20%2Fetc%2Finit.d%2Fdropbear%20start%3B

回车,网页显示{“code”:0},再在abcdefg1234567890这段代码后添加以下网址:

1
/api/misystem/set_config_iotdev?bssid=Xiaomi&user_id=longdike&ssid=-h%3B%20echo%20-e%20'admin%5Cnadmin'%20%7C%20passwd%20root%3B

回车,网页显示{“code”:0},重启

刷breed

下载breed,https://breed.hackpascal.net/breed-mt7621-xiaomi-r3g.bin
下载http服务器工具hfs,http://www.rejetto.com/hfs/download
使用putty或xshell或其他ssh工具,连接地址:192.168.31.1,用户名:root 密码:admin
运行hfs,把breed-mt7621-xiaomi-r3g.bin拖进去,点一下文件,复制整个地址到wget后面

1
2
3
cd /tmp
wget http://192.168.1.100/breed-mt7621-xiaomi-r3g.bin
mtd -r write breed-mt7621-xiaomi-r3g.bin Bootloader

刷固件

断电,用卡针戳路由器背后Reset小孔(有段落感),保持住的同时插上电源,几秒后路由器的System灯开始闪烁后,浏览器输入192.168.1.1进入breed
找到环境变量,增加:xiaomi.r3g.bootfw,值:2,然后保存,重启
断电,用卡针戳路由器背后Reset小孔(有段落感),保持住的同时插上电源,几秒后路由器的System灯开始闪烁后,浏览器输入192.168.1.1进入breed
点击更新固件,我用的固件https://www.right.com.cn/forum/thread-4126310-1-1.html
下载地址:https://wwa.lanzoui.com/b00ok39gd 密码:7ov8
重启后成功

参考资料

http://openwrt.ink:88/archives/s-breed